This Mouthwatering One Pot Lasagna Soup brings all the comforting flavors of classic lasagna into one hearty and easy-to-make soup. Packed with ground beef, lasagna noodles, rich tomato broth, and creamy cheeses, it’s the ultimate cozy meal for any night.
Ingredients
- 1 lb ground beef
- 3 garlic cloves, finely minced
- 1/2 yellow onion, diced
- 1/2 tsp garlic powder
- 1/2 tsp onion powder
- 1/4 tsp dried basil
- 1/2 tsp dried oregano
- 1 tsp kosher salt, plus more as needed
- Freshly ground black pepper, to taste
- 1 (14 oz) can crushed tomatoes
- 32 oz chicken broth, more if needed
- 1 cup water
- 2 tsp tomato paste
- 6 oz lasagna noodles, broken up
- 1 cup frozen chopped spinach
- 1/4 cup heavy cream
- For serving:
- Ricotta cheese
- 4 oz mozzarella cheese, cut in slices
- Parmesan cheese, optional
Instructions
- In a large pot, cook ground beef over medium heat until browned. Drain any excess fat.
- Add minced garlic and diced onion. Sauté for 2–3 minutes until softened and fragrant.
- Stir in garlic powder, onion powder, basil, oregano, salt, and black pepper.
- Add crushed tomatoes, chicken broth, water, and tomato paste. Stir well to combine.
- Bring to a boil, then add broken lasagna noodles.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er uncovered for 12–15 minutes, stirring occasionally, until noodles are tender.
- Add frozen spinach and cook for another 2–3 minutes.
- Stir in heavy cream, adjust seasoning if needed, and simmer 1 more minute.
- Serve hot topped with ricotta, mozzarella, and Parmesan cheese.
Notes
- For extra flavor, add a pinch of red pepper flakes or a splash of balsamic vinegar.
- You can substitute ground beef with Italian sausage or turkey for a lighter version.
- Leftovers taste even better the next day as the flavors deepen.
